Overview

This is the second review from Structural-Safety and covers the period from December 2012 to December 2014 for work done by SCOSS (Standing Committee for Structural Safety) and CROSS (Confidential Reporting on Structural Safety). It is the 19th review since SCOSS was formed in 1976.

Note: this review was published by Structural-Safety. Since March 2021, Structural-Safety is integrated under the name Collaborative Reporting for Safer Structures (CROSS).
